## Releases

Frostlane handlers are serverless; cold starts dominate p99 after every deploy. Mitigations, in order: provisioned warm pool (6 instances per region), snapshot restore, lazy dependency init. Never ship all regions at once — stagger by 30 minutes so the warm pool refills. Watch the `coldstart_ms` dashboard for an hour post-deploy; anything over 1800ms means the snapshot didn't take. Rollbacks reuse the previous snapshot and are cheap.

All release bundles must be signed before upload. The current release signing key is below.

signing key of bagap-yawep = bky13_TbfT6ZMUoGJo2

Ticket: Unlock migration vault for Ironvine ORM refactor

New team members: the legacy Ironvine ORM layer is being replaced module by module, and the schema snapshots needed for safe refactoring sit in a locked vault nobody has opened since the last owner left. We recovered the credentials from escrow this week. The passphrase follows below.

unlock words, kajog-yawip: istwyn-casath-aldok

## Configuration: Vendored Fonts

Glyphcart vendors all third-party typefaces into `assets/fonts/` at build time rather than fetching them at runtime, ensuring reproducible releases. The sync script verifies checksums against the Typeholm registry manifest before copying. Because the registry restricts licensed font downloads, the release environment must authenticate; ensure the .env contains this line before running the sync:

secret setting of bagag-fafof: LEDGER_TOKEN29=2087e95a7be258fc3f2cc54ea20c7

**Ticket QF-318: Per-tenant rate quotas.** Implements configurable request quotas per tenant in the Marrowgate API layer, replacing the global cap. Defaults are conservative; overrides live in the tenant config table. Future maintainers: quota changes require a sign-off before deploy. This change cannot ship until approval is recorded by the responsible party.

signatory, kaweg-fawig: Zorys Druys Jorius Novael